What could be causing these problems?
Blowing white smoke, lack of power, slow shifting.

White smoke from exhaust indicates coolant leaking into combustion chamber and being burnt out the exhaust. Normally caused by a cracked head or intake gasket. Check your coolant level and see if it is low. If it is, need to have engine inspected at reputable repair shop to see what is damaged.
